Transaction e51a08181c7affc7932cf50143d8feea5fba25e49c811c73d18624035aae569a

1 Input
2 Outputs
  • e51a08181c7affc7932cf50143d8feea5fba25e49c811c73d18624035aae569a:0
  • value  1161945
    address  1PciTR2Hnvx2NbnwaPWX97T5DgH5YRqeFz
  • e51a08181c7affc7932cf50143d8feea5fba25e49c811c73d18624035aae569a:1
  • value  34811989
    address  3KnHY7y4sSKqNQZj358DgxYncN8eYEU6dB